    What is Hostess Job Description?

    A hostess is a person employed at an establishment such as a restaurant, hotel, or other public accommodation, whose primary responsibility is to greet and seat guests. Hostesses may also be responsible for taking reservations, providing customer service, and managing waitlists. Hostesses may also be responsible for other duties, such as stocking shelves, stocking ingredients, and cleaning. Hostesses may also be responsible for taking customer orders and delivering food. Hostesses may also be responsible for setting up tables and chairs, and cleaning up after guests.

    What Does a Good Hostess Look Like?

    A good hostess should be friendly, outgoing, and welcoming. They should be knowledgeable about the establishment and its services and be able to answer questions from guests. Hostesses should also be able to handle a variety of tasks and multitask when necessary. Hostesses should also be able to handle difficult situations with guests in a professional manner.
